Chaos and Creation Unite

This combination of cards suggests a powerful clash between nurturing energy and tumultuous change, leading to conflict and competition. The Empress embodies fertility and creation, while The Tower signifies unexpected upheaval, and the Five of Wands introduces strife and rivalry. Together, they indicate a transformative period that challenges existing structures and relationships.

All Upright

When all three cards are upright, the reading suggests that a period of creativity and growth (The Empress) is about to face a significant disruption (The Tower), leading to conflict (Five of Wands). This upheaval may force individuals to confront their values and relationships, prompting necessary change. Ultimately, it’s about harnessing chaos to foster innovation and personal development.

The Empress Reversed

When The Empress is reversed, it indicates a struggle with self-worth and nurturing, potentially leading to stagnation or neglect of creative projects. This can create an environment ripe for conflict, as individuals may feel unrecognized or undervalued. The clash with The Tower becomes more pronounced, highlighting the need to reclaim personal power.

The Tower Reversed

The Tower reversed suggests avoidance of necessary change or a fear of upheaval that leads to stagnation. Individuals may resist the transformative energies present, opting for the safety of the familiar even if it is unfulfilling. This resistance can exacerbate the underlying tensions indicated by the Five of Wands.

Five of Wands Reversed

The Five of Wands reversed points to a desire to avoid conflict but may also signify a lack of direction or purpose in resolving disputes. It can indicate a retreat from competition or an inability to find common ground. This card suggests that while the desire for harmony is there, unresolved issues may fester beneath the surface.

All Reversed

With all three cards reversed, the reading depicts a period of stagnation characterized by avoidance and unaddressed conflict. The Empress’s nurturing energy is blocked, The Tower’s potential for transformation is resisted, and the Five of Wands indicates internal strife without resolution. This combination calls for introspection and a willingness to confront uncomfortable truths.

Love & Relationships

In love and relationships, this combination suggests that unresolved issues or fears of change may be hindering emotional growth. The nurturing aspects of The Empress may be stifled, leading to misunderstandings and conflict. Couples should seek to address underlying issues to foster a deeper connection.

Career & Finances

In career and finances, this reading warns against ignoring necessary transformations that could lead to growth. The resistance to change may create an environment of competition and conflict, preventing progress. It is essential to embrace new opportunities and adapt to shifts in the workplace.

Advice

The advice here is to confront fears of change and embrace the chaos as a catalyst for growth. Rather than avoiding conflict, engage in open communication to resolve underlying tensions. Use this transformative period to reassess your values and priorities, allowing new beginnings to flourish.
